Q » How can diet and nutrition support my hair

A » To support hair health, incorporate a balanced diet rich in proteins, vitamins, and minerals. Essential nutrients include biotin, vitamin E, iron, and omega-3 fatty acids, found in foods like eggs, nuts, leafy greens, and fish. These nutrients strengthen hair follicles, promote growth, and prevent breakage. Additionally, staying hydrated and minimizing processed foods can enhance overall hair vitality, ensuring it remains lustrous and healthy.

A »To support healthy hair, prioritize a balanced diet rich in essential nutrients. Incorporate protein sources like lean meats, fish, and legumes, as hair is primarily made of keratin, a protein. Include omega-3 fatty acids from fish or flaxseeds for scalp health. Vitamins A, C, D, and E, along with zinc and biotin, play crucial roles in hair growth and strength. Stay hydrated and minimize processed foods for optimal results.
